Volta River in Ghana |
Five children have so far been confirmed dead in an accidenton the Volta River.
A boat carrying 70 persons and goods
capsized on the river at a location close to Yeji. They were said to be
passengers from a village known as Nantwie Akura.
A survivor, Alex Yaw Adjei Biney who
lost two of his children in the accident narrated to the sorry in an
interview that water started rushing into the boat while on the river.
The accident, he said occurred after the boat drivers missed
their paths. The drivers, he said were not the true owners of the boat.
According to Alex who claimed he was
able to rescue his mother who was also a passenger in the boat, there are still
bodies in the river which are yet to be rescued.
